  • Q: What is the main theme of 'Comparative work ethics: Judeo-Christian, Islamic, and Eastern'? A: The book explores the differing work ethics across Judeo-Christian, Islamic, and Eastern traditions, analyzing how these cultural perspectives influence attitudes toward work and productivity.
  • Q: Who is the author of this book? A: The author of 'Comparative work ethics: Judeo-Christian, Islamic, and Eastern' is Jaroslav Pelikan, a noted scholar in religious studies and history.
